Larry Fitzgerald, Wide Receiver

After a down year in 2014, a resurgent Fitzgerald has been the most pleasant surprise for the Arizona Cardinals this season. Palmer and Fitzgerald have been one of the best QB-WR duos this season, and still half 8+ more games to go. Fitzgerald is tied for second in the league with touchdown receptions at 7, and is expected to have many more come January. Fitzgerald should make his fiirst return to the Pro Bowl roster since 2013.

Jared Veldheer, Tackle

Left tackle Jared Veldheer has done a tremendous job in keeping Carson Palmer on his feet. So far this season, Palmer has only been sacked 11 times, which is tied for 25th in the league. A majority of the team’s success is attributed to Palmer, however Veldheer is one of the leading catalysts for Palmer’s hot start to the first half of the season. While he had some troubles with penalties at the beginning of the season, Veldheer has become much more disciplined and has become the anchor on this dominant offensive line.
